Greg Benson is the CEO of Mediocre Films and his YouTube channel recently passed 100 Million views. That’s an incredible achievement.
He moved to Hollywood to finesse his waiting skills but soon found that he just wasn’t cut out for the service industry. To pass the time Greg wrote, produced and directed some of the funniest web videos of recent years like “Greg Hits Hollywood” and “Yeshmin Blechin”. He also directed for other hit shows like “The Guild” and “Gorgeous Tiny Chicken Machine Show”.
In Part 1, Greg talks about how he started in show business and takes us from his Texan roots to his Hollywood home with the stars, how he met his wife, ace producer Kim Evey, and why he moved from TV to web video.
